Hatching Timetables for Backyard Chickens

Figuring out when those fluffy chicks will hatch is a key part of backyard chicken keeping. The incubation period, which is the time it takes for an egg to grow, typically lasts around three weeks. However, there can be some differences depending on the type of chicken and factors like temperature.

To get a more accurate calendar, it's helpful to monitor your eggs carefully. Look for signs of progress inside the egg, such as a visible membrane or changes in color. You can also use an brooder with a built-in thermometer to maintain the optimal temperature needed for hatching.
